William Shatner celebrates 94th birthday with charity work


William Shatner knows it is better to give than to receive … and that Las Vegas is very fun.

Alum “Star Trek” plans Celebrate his 94th birthday On Saturday, volunteering – as he has been the last 35 years – in his charity organization.

“In recent years I celebrated my birthday by working on a very successful charity organization called The Hollywood Charity Horse Show,” the 94-year-old revealed People magazine. “We have been doing it for 35 years and we have raised millions of dollars for children and veterans.”

Shatner began a charity organization in 1990 after watching handicapped children working with horses.

“Shatner sat, deeply affected by what he saw, saying,” You can’t watch these children without knowing you have to help somehow, “said the charity organization on your website.

The charity organization added: “One special Saturday night every year, William Shatner brings together horses and world class riders in amazing diamonds and gardens while competing for top honors in their classes,” with all revenue to go for charity.

Like his charity work, the “Boston Legal” actor also plans to go to son City with his family.

“My family takes me to Las Vegas for dinner and show, then back to Los Angeles,” he told People. “It will be a family experience in that wonderful, fun city. I’m really looking forward to it.”

Shatner shared his tips for Staying young last year On your 93rd birthday, saying to people, “Just stay engaged in life, stay curious. But happiness has a lot to do with it in your health.”
